ITEM NO.9 COURT NO.14 SECTION XII-A

S U P R E M E C O U R T O F I N D I A RECORD OF PROCEEDINGS

SPECIAL LEAVE PETITION (CIVIL) DIARY NO. 41367/2023

(Arising out of impugned final judgment and order dated 07-06-2023 in CRP No. 852/2019 and CRP No. 888/2019 passed by the High Court For The State Of Telangana At Hyderabad)

KYLASA NAVEEN KUMAR PETITIONER

VERSUS

ALPESH SHAH RESPONDENT

( IA No.214825/2023-CONDONATION OF DELAY IN FILING and IA No.214827/2023-EXEMPTION FROM FILING C/C OF THE IMPUGNED JUDGMENT and IA No.214829/2023-PERMISSION TO FILE ADDITIONAL DOCUMENTS/FACTS/ANNEXURES )

Date : 18-10-2023 This petition was called on for hearing today.

CORAM : HON'BLE MS. JUSTICE HIMA KOHLI HON'BLE MR. JUSTICE AHSANUDDIN AMANULLAH

For Petitioner(s)

Mr. Shravanth Paruchuri, AOR Mr. Nithin Chowdary Pavuluri, Adv. Mr. Subham Saurabh, Adv.

For Respondent(s)

UPON hearing the counsel, the Court made the following O R D E R

  1. Learned counsel for the petitioner seeks leave to withdraw the present

petitions while reserving the right of the petitioner to file a petition seeking

review of the impugned order dated 07th June, 2023, passed by the High

Court.

  1. Leave, as prayed for, is granted.

  2. The Petitions for Special Leave to Appeal are dismissed as withdrawn.

  3. However, in the event the petitioner does not succeed in the review petition, he shall be entitled to approach this Court for appropriate remedy.
